TOOLS NEEDED

Screwdriver

Pipe Wrench

MATERIALS NEEDED

Pipe Thread Tape
or Sealant

One 6” x 1 1/2” TBE PVC
Nipple

One Hose Adapter
1 1/2” x 1 1/2” x 1 1/4”

One Section of
1 1/2” Flex Hose
(provided with filter)

One
Hose Clamp

RECOMMENDED

Corrosion Resistant
Check Valve

4-8 psi Back Pressure

To avoid over or under chlorination,
replace eye ball fittings in the return
jets to a smaller or larger size to
adjust back pressure.

Above Ground, Filter Installation - Model 120

Apply pipe thread tape or
sealant to each threaded end
of nipple.

Screw one end of nipple
into the filter return.

Hand tighten. Finish tightening
by turning 1 to 2 revolutions
with wrench.
DO NOT OVER TIGHTEN.

Screw either side of
New Water® Cycler on
to open nipple end until
upright and secure.

Apply pipe thread tape or
sealant to threaded end
of hose adapter.
